    Under cabinet light melting

    The other night the LED over the sink started to smell like burning plastic. It became hot to the touch so we turned it off. I removed it and saw that the inside was starting to melt. Has anybody heard of this before? It is a Intertek Facon model DDSO1-608.

    Not had this issue but LEDs are by nature low heat vs standard bulbs. So for this to happen, there was a wiring short somewhere. Could be just an internally defective bulb so replace the light but also check for wiring issues up to the bulb from source just to be safe.
